How to Choose a Shower Bench for Your Bathtub

A shower bench is a convenient and practical addition to any bathroom, providing a safe and comfortable place to sit while showering. When choosing a shower bench for your bathtub, it is important to consider the size and shape of the bathtub, the material and durability of the bench, and the specific needs of the user.
Size and Shape of the Bathtub
The size and shape of the bathtub is one of the most important factors to consider when choosing a shower bench. A bench that is too large or too small will not fit comfortably in the bathtub and may impede movement during showering. Additionally, the shape of the bathtub, whether it is square, rectangular, or curved, will impact the shape of the bench that is needed to fit comfortably within the space.
Material and Durability
The material and durability of the shower bench is another important factor to consider when choosing a bench for your bathtub. The bench should be made from a durable material that is resistant to water and mildew, and is able to withstand the weight of the user. Additionally, the bench should be designed to provide maximum support and stability, while also being comfortable and easy to clean.
Weight Capacity
The weight capacity of the shower bench is also an important factor to consider when choosing a bench for your bathtub. The bench must be able to support the weight of the user without bending or breaking. It is important to choose a bench with a weight capacity that exceeds the weight of the user to ensure that it is safe and stable.
Armrests and Backrests
Armrests and backrests can also be important features to consider when choosing a shower bench for your bathtub. These features can provide added support and stability during showering, reducing the risk of slips, falls, and other accidents. Additionally, armrests and backrests can improve comfort and reduce physical strain during showering.
Adjustable Height
Many shower benches come with adjustable height options, which can be beneficial for individuals with specific mobility or balance needs. An adjustable height bench can be raised or lowered to accommodate the individual's specific needs, ensuring maximum comfort and safety during showering.
Non-Slip Surface
The surface of the bench should be designed to be non-slip, providing a safe and stable place to sit during showering. This is particularly important for individuals with mobility or balance issues, as well as older adults and those with disabilities who may be at a higher risk of falling.
Style and Aesthetics
Finally, the style and aesthetics of the shower bench should also be considered when choosing a bench for your bathtub. The bench should complement the overall design and decor of the bathroom, while also providing the necessary comfort and support for safe and convenient showering.
In addition to these factors, it is important to consider the specific needs of the user when choosing a shower bench for a bathtub. Individuals with mobility or balance issues may require a bench with a wider base or additional support to ensure that they can sit and stand safely and comfortably. Additionally, individuals with limited mobility or balance may require a bench with a specific shape or design that accommodates their specific needs.
Type of Installation
When choosing a shower bench for your bathtub, it is important to consider the type of installation that is needed. Some shower benches require drilling or mounting onto the walls of the bathroom, while others may be freestanding or suction-cup based. The type of installation that is best for your bathtub will depend on the specific needs and preferences of the user, as well as the design and layout of the bathroom.
Portability
If you are looking for a shower bench that can be easily moved or transported, a portable bench may be the best option. Portable shower benches can be easily folded up and stored when not in use, and can be taken with you when traveling or visiting friends and family. Portable shower benches are also a good option for individuals who may need to move the bench around in the bathroom for accessibility or convenience purposes.
